The law starts…
“A person who publicly recites, publicly distributes, publishes or publicly displays a prohibited expression in a way that might reasonably be expected to cause a member of the public to feel menaced, harassed or offended commits an offence”
Merely saying “from the river to the sea” isn’t illegal here in Queensland. And while it’s a moronic law and Crissafuli is an idiot, sensationalist reporting like this doesn’t help.
